WebLiteracy-Rich Environments with a Theme Ms. Fassler’s second grade class is studying weather. In her literacy-rich classroom you can find students: • Reading books on weather • Exploring labels around the classroom identifying weather vocabulary • Learning content on raindrops and clouds • Drawing pictures of the different types of clouds
